How to Build for Decentralized Systems

Alessandro Cappellato Ferrari

Building for blockchain no longer requires learning niche languages. Discover how to deploy decentralized, hyper-optimized applications using the Python and TypeScript tools you already know.

#1 about 3 min

Comparing cloud computing to blockchain programming paradigms

Transitioning from centralized cloud systems to decentralized network nodes requires adopting an asynchronous programming approach.

#2 about 2 min

Applying blockchain for traceability in regulated industries

Healthcare and pharmaceutical sectors use immutable hashing to ensure clinical trial results remain tamper-proof for regulators.

#3 about 1 min

Building supply chain transparency with distributed ledgers

Multiple untrusting parties can share a verifiable timeline of product origins to meet compliance requirements.

#4 about 3 min

Managing digital ownership natively through non-fungible tokens

Decentralized ledgers allow airlines and event organizers to create frictionless secondary markets for digital tickets.

#5 about 2 min

Enabling access to real estate through fractionalization

Dividing physical assets into digital fractions allows multiple parties to share ownership and rental yields.

#6 about 2 min

Improving fintech operations and cross-border settlement speeds

Decentralized networks replace complex backend queues with direct micropayments and instant international settlements.

#7 about 2 min

Mitigating counterparty risk using atomic transaction swaps

Multiple interdependent transactions only clear if all conditions are met, eliminating the need for escrow middlemen.

#8 about 2 min

Choosing between smart contracts and native blockchain assets

Developers must weigh the infinite programmability of pure on-chain logic against the simplified safety of native SDK calls.

#9 about 2 min

Developing local blockchain applications using familiar languages

Writing decentralized programs in Python and TypeScript lowers the learning curve and leverages existing testing frameworks.

#10 about 6 min

Scaffolding and deploying a smart contract locally

The AlgoKit command line interface generates production-ready environments with continuous integration and dependency management.

#11 about 2 min

Visualizing complex blockchain transactions with block explorers

Translating raw database rows into visual flow charts simplifies the debugging of aggregated decentralized trades.
